What Exactly is Hyundai Complimentary Maintenance (HCM)?

Hyundai Complimentary Maintenance is a programme designed to cover the normal, factory-scheduled maintenance intervals for eligible new Hyundai vehicles. Specifically, for new 2025 model year Hyundai vehicles, this programme provides coverage for a period of 3 years or 36,000 miles, whichever comes first. This means that for the specified duration, certain key maintenance services are provided at no additional cost to the original owner.

The primary aim of HCM is to encourage new owners to adhere to the manufacturer's recommended service schedule, ensuring their vehicle operates optimally from day one. It removes the guesswork and the immediate financial outlay for standard services, allowing you to simply enjoy your new Hyundai with greater peace of mind.

Key Services Included in the HCM Programme

The HCM programme focuses on the fundamental services necessary for routine vehicle health. These are the cornerstones of preventative maintenance that every car needs to function efficiently and safely.

Engine Oil and Oil Filter Changes

At the heart of your Hyundai’s engine is its oil, which acts as a lubricant, coolant, and cleaning agent. Over time, engine oil breaks down and becomes contaminated, losing its effectiveness. Regular oil and oil filter changes are paramount to keeping your engine running smoothly, preventing excessive wear on moving parts, and maintaining optimal fuel efficiency. The oil filter traps contaminants, preventing them from circulating through the engine. The HCM programme ensures these vital services are performed at the recommended intervals, using high-quality Hyundai Recommended Oil and Hyundai Genuine Oil Filters. This is a critical service, applicable to all petrol and diesel vehicles, ensuring the engine’s longevity and performance. Electric vehicles, of course, are exempt from this specific service as they do not have a conventional internal combustion engine requiring oil changes.

Tyre Rotations

Tyres are your vehicle’s only point of contact with the road, and their condition directly impacts handling, braking, and safety. Uneven tyre wear can lead to reduced grip, increased road noise, and a shorter lifespan for your tyres. Tyre rotations involve moving your vehicle's tyres to different positions (e.g., front to rear, side to side) to ensure they wear evenly. This simple yet effective service helps to maximise the life of your tyres, improve fuel economy, and maintain balanced handling characteristics. Consistent tyre rotations, covered by HCM, contribute significantly to your driving safety and overall vehicle efficiency.

Multi-Point Inspection

A multi-point inspection is a comprehensive visual check of your vehicle’s critical components, performed by certified Hyundai technicians. It's like a health check-up for your car, designed to identify potential issues before they become major problems. This inspection typically covers a wide range of areas, including:

  • Brake system (pads, rotors, fluid levels)
  • Fluid levels and condition (coolant, power steering, washer fluid)
  • Battery health and charging system
  • Belts and hoses
  • Suspension components
  • Exhaust system
  • Lighting (headlights, tail lights, indicators)
  • Wiper blades
  • Tyre pressure and condition (beyond just wear)
  • Steering components

The multi-point inspection is incredibly valuable as it provides an early warning system for wear and tear, allowing you to address minor issues before they escalate into more significant, and often more expensive, repairs. It’s a proactive approach to vehicle maintenance that complements the specific services included in HCM.

Exclusions and Limitations of the HCM Programme

While the HCM programme offers significant benefits, it’s important to understand its limitations. It covers *normal, factory-scheduled maintenance intervals*. This means certain scenarios and additional services are not included:

  • More Frequent Maintenance Due to Severe Driving Conditions: If your driving habits fall under what is considered 'severe usage' (e.g., frequent short trips, driving in extreme temperatures, towing, extensive idling in traffic, driving on dusty or unpaved roads), your vehicle may require more frequent servicing than the standard factory schedule. These additional services are not covered by HCM.
  • Additional Services and Parts: The programme is focused on the specified routine maintenance items. It does not cover wear-and-tear items such as brake pads, wiper blades, light bulbs, or components requiring replacement due to normal wear or damage. Any services beyond oil changes, tyre rotations, and multi-point inspections (e.g., fluid flushes, spark plug replacement, major repairs) are also excluded.
  • Electric Vehicles: As mentioned, EVs do not require engine oil changes or traditional oil filters. While they still benefit from tyre rotations and multi-point inspections, their specific maintenance needs (like battery health checks or cabin air filter replacements) fall outside the scope of the engine-centric services.

It's always advisable to consult your Hyundai owner's manual for a detailed maintenance schedule and to discuss your driving conditions with your authorised Hyundai service centre to ensure your vehicle receives all necessary care.

Is the Hyundai Complimentary Maintenance programme transferable to a new owner if I sell my car?

No, the benefits of the Hyundai Complimentary Maintenance programme are exclusively for the original owner of the eligible vehicle. They are not transferable to subsequent owners.

What if I drive less than 36,000 miles in 3 years?

The programme covers you for 3 years or 36,000 miles, whichever comes first. So, if you drive less, you will still benefit from the included services for the full three-year period.

What if I drive more than 36,000 miles before 3 years are up?

If you exceed 36,000 miles before the three-year mark, the complimentary maintenance programme will conclude at the 36,000-mile limit. Any subsequent maintenance will be at your own expense, though you may consider an Extended Hyundai Protection Plan.

Do I have to get my car serviced at a specific Hyundai dealership?

To benefit from the complimentary nature of the programme, all services must be performed at an authorised Hyundai service centre. This ensures the work is carried out by trained technicians using genuine parts.

How do I schedule a service appointment under the HCM programme?

You should contact your local authorised Hyundai dealer’s service department directly to schedule your maintenance appointment. Inform them that your vehicle is eligible for the Hyundai Complimentary Maintenance programme.

Does HCM cover wear-and-tear items like brake pads or wiper blades?

No, the HCM programme specifically covers routine, factory-scheduled maintenance items such as oil and oil filter changes, tyre rotations, and multi-point inspections. Wear-and-tear items like brake pads, wiper blades, light bulbs, and other parts that naturally degrade with use are not included and are the owner's responsibility.

Are software updates included in the complimentary maintenance?

While not explicitly part of the HCM programme, authorised Hyundai service centres often perform necessary software updates during routine service visits as a matter of course. It's a good practice to inquire about any available updates during your appointment.

What if my vehicle requires maintenance more frequently due to severe driving conditions?

The HCM programme covers *normal* factory-scheduled maintenance. If your driving conditions are considered 'severe' (e.g., heavy towing, extreme temperatures, dusty roads), your vehicle may require more frequent service intervals than standard. These additional, more frequent services are not covered by the HCM programme and would be at the owner's expense.
